WebA lower-than-normal level of chloride is called hypochloremia. It helps keep the amount of fluid inside and outside of your cells in balance. It also helps maintain proper blood volume, blood pressure, and pH of your body fluids. Tests for sodium, potassium, and bicarbonate are usually done at the same time as a blood test for chloride. dr timer wowWebJul 11, 2024 · What foods are high in chloride in blood?
